草庐IT

mysqli_ping

全部标签

python - Python中的多个ping脚本

我找不到任何关于python和网络的易于学习的好文档。在这种情况下,我只是想制作一个简单的脚本,我可以ping一些远程机器。forpinginrange(1,10):ip="127.0.0."+str(ping)os.system("ping-c3%s"%ip)这样的简单脚本可以很好地ping机器,但我想让脚本返回“事件”“无响应”,这让我觉得我也必须查看时间模块,我想想time.sleep(5)之后,会有一个break语句。这让我觉得for里面应该有一个while循环。我不是100%肯定,我可能完全走错了方向:/如果有人可以帮助或指出一些很棒的文档的方向。

python - 用 Python ping 一个站点?

如何使用Pythonping网站或IP地址? 最佳答案 查看purePythonping由MatthewDixonCowles和JensDiemer.另外,请记住Python需要root才能在linux中生成ICMP(即ping)套接字。importping,sockettry:ping.verbose_ping('www.google.com',count=3)delay=ping.Ping('www.wikipedia.org',timeout=2000).do()exceptsocket.error,e:print"PingE

java - 如何从 Windows 执行真正的 Java ping?

我正在尝试通过我的Java程序ping网络上的设备。通过我的windows命令提示符,我可以很好地ping设备地址并对地址进行跟踪。在网上,我看到要通过Java执行ping操作,您必须执行以下操作:InetAddress.getByName(address).isReachable(timeout);但是,当我在我的设备地址上使用此代码时,它总是在我的程序中返回false。我正在使用具有良好超时值的正确IPv4地址。另外,如果我使用localhost地址,它也可以正常工作。为什么我可以通过cmdping设备,但不能通过我的程序?我在很多地方都听说这不是一个真实的ping。有没有更好的方

Mysql主/从复制。即使读取查询也连接到主? (驱动程序 "ping"在去从属之前是否主控?)

我在ReplicationDriver中使用mysql主/从复制(写入主从读取)。我的连接URL如下:"jdbc:mysql:replication://master:3306,slave1:3307,slave2:3308/sampledb?allowMasterDownConnections=true"我使用Spring+SpringMyBatis模块。我已将我的交易标记为只读,如下所示:@Override@Transactional(rollbackFor=Exception.class,readOnly=true)publicSamplegetSample(SampleKeys

php - MySQLi count(*) 总是返回 1

我正在尝试计算表中的行数,并认为这是正确的方法:$result=$db->query("SELECTCOUNT(*)FROM`table`;");$count=$result->num_rows;但counts总是返回(int)1。如果我在phpMyAdmin中使用相同的查询,我会得到正确的结果。它位于一个表中,因此我也尝试测试$count[0],但返回NULL。这样做的正确方法是什么? 最佳答案 你必须获取那一条记录,它将包含Count()的结果$result=$db->query("SELECTCOUNT(*)FROM`tabl

php - mysqli_fetch_array() 期望参数 1 为 mysqli_result, boolean 值

这个问题在这里已经有了答案:Whattodowithmysqliproblems?Errorslikemysqli_fetch_array():Argument#1mustbeoftypemysqli_resultandsuch(1个回答)关闭9年前。我在检查我的数据库中是否已经存在FacebookUser_id时遇到了一些麻烦(如果不存在,则它应该接受该用户作为新用户,否则只需加载Canvas应用程序)。我在托管服务器上运行它并没有问题,但在我的本地主机上它给了我以下错误:mysqli_fetch_array()expectsparameter1tobemysqli_result,b

PHP & MySQL : mysqli_num_rows() expects parameter 1 to be mysqli_result, bool 值

这个问题在这里已经有了答案:Whattodowithmysqliproblems?Errorslikemysqli_fetch_array():Argument#1mustbeoftypemysqli_resultandsuch(1个回答)关闭7年前。我正在尝试集成HTMLPurifierhttp://htmlpurifier.org/过滤我的用户提交的数据,但我收到以下错误。我想知道如何解决这个问题?我收到以下错误。online22:mysqli_num_rows()expectsparameter1tobemysqli_result,booleangiven第22行是。if(mys

php mysqli_connect : authentication method unknown to the client [caching_sha2_password]

我正在使用phpmysqli_connect登录MySQL数据库(都在本地主机上)这是mysql.user表:MySQL服务器ini文件:[mysqld]#Thedefaultauthenticationplugintobeusedwhenconnectingtotheserverdefault_authentication_plugin=caching_sha2_password#default_authentication_plugin=mysql_native_password在MySQL服务器ini文件中使用caching_sha2_password,根本不可能使用user1或

php - 如何将mysql更改为mysqli?

根据下面我用于常规mysql的代码,如何将其转换为使用mysqli?就如将mysql_query($sql);改为mysqli_query($sql);那么简单吗?AnInternalErrorhasOccured.Pleasereportfollowingerrortothewebmaster.".mysql_error()."'");mysql_select_db($DB['dbName']);//endheaderconnectionpart//functionfromafunctionsfilethatIrunamysqlquerythroughinanypage.functi

php - 将 Mysqli bind_param 与日期和时间列一起使用?

如何使用PHPmysqli和bind_param将数据插入MySQL日期或时间列? 最佳答案 和其他字符串一样$stmt=$mysqli->prepare('insertintofoo(dt)values(?)');$dt='2009-04-3010:09:00';$stmt->bind_param('s',$dt);$stmt->execute(); 关于php-将Mysqlibind_param与日期和时间列一起使用?,我们在StackOverflow上找到一个类似的问题: